mirror of
https://github.com/Relintai/broken_seals.git
synced 2024-11-13 20:47:19 +01:00
Added osx (and commented out ios) build commands to the build all script.
This commit is contained in:
parent
e5f0d7b0d2
commit
7004ce14a4
@ -13,6 +13,11 @@ img_version=bs
|
|||||||
|
|
||||||
mkdir -p logs
|
mkdir -p logs
|
||||||
|
|
||||||
|
#sudo podman run -i -t -v $(pwd)/files:/root/files godot-osx:bs /bin/bash
|
||||||
|
#sudo podman run -i -t -v $(pwd)/:/root/project -w /root/project godot-osx:bs /bin/bash
|
||||||
|
#sudo podman run -v $(pwd)/:/root/project -w /root/project godot-osx:bs scons bex_strip arch=x86_64 -j4 osxcross_sdk=darwin20.4
|
||||||
|
|
||||||
|
|
||||||
rm -f engine/modules/modules_enabled.gen.h
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
$podman run -v ${project_root}:/root/project -w /root/project godot-windows:${img_version} scons bew_strip -j4 . 2>&1 | tee logs/bew.log
|
$podman run -v ${project_root}:/root/project -w /root/project godot-windows:${img_version} scons bew_strip -j4 . 2>&1 | tee logs/bew.log
|
||||||
rm -f engine/modules/modules_enabled.gen.h
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
@ -46,6 +51,29 @@ rm -f engine/modules/modules_enabled.gen.h
|
|||||||
$podman run -v ${project_root}:/root/project -w /root/project godot-android:${img_version} scons bar_strip -j4 . 2>&1 | tee logs/bar.log
|
$podman run -v ${project_root}:/root/project -w /root/project godot-android:${img_version} scons bar_strip -j4 . 2>&1 | tee logs/bar.log
|
||||||
rm -f engine/modules/modules_enabled.gen.h
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
|
||||||
|
#osx
|
||||||
|
$podman run -v ${project_root}:/root/project -w /root/project godot-osx:${img_version} scons bex_strip arch=x86_64 -j4 osxcross_sdk=darwin20.4 . 2>&1 | tee logs/bex_x86_64.log
|
||||||
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
$podman run -v ${project_root}:/root/project -w /root/project godot-osx:${img_version} scons bex_strip arch=arm64 -j4 osxcross_sdk=darwin20.4 . 2>&1 | tee logs/bex_arm64.log
|
||||||
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
#todo lipo script
|
||||||
|
|
||||||
|
$podman run -v ${project_root}:/root/project -w /root/project godot-osx:${img_version} scons bx_strip arch=x86_64 -j4 osxcross_sdk=darwin20.4 . 2>&1 | tee logs/bx_x86_64.log
|
||||||
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
$podman run -v ${project_root}:/root/project -w /root/project godot-osx:${img_version} scons bx_strip arch=arm64 -j4 osxcross_sdk=darwin20.4 . 2>&1 | tee logs/bx_arm64.log
|
||||||
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
#todo lipo script
|
||||||
|
|
||||||
|
$podman run -v ${project_root}:/root/project -w /root/project godot-osx:${img_version} scons bxr_strip arch=x86_64 -j4 osxcross_sdk=darwin20.4 . 2>&1 | tee logs/bxr_x86_64.log
|
||||||
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
$podman run -v ${project_root}:/root/project -w /root/project godot-osx:${img_version} scons bxr_strip arch=arm64 -j4 osxcross_sdk=darwin20.4 . 2>&1 | tee logs/bxr_arm64.log
|
||||||
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
#todo lipo script
|
||||||
|
|
||||||
|
#ios
|
||||||
|
#$podman run -v ${project_root}:/root/project -w /root/project godot-ios:${img_version} scons bir_strip -j4 . 2>&1 | tee logs/bir.log
|
||||||
|
#r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
|
||||||
# $podman run -v ${project_root}:/root/project -i -w /root/project -t godot-windows:${img_version} scons bew -j4
|
# $podman run -v ${project_root}:/root/project -i -w /root/project -t godot-windows:${img_version} scons bew -j4
|
||||||
rm -f engine/modules/modules_enabled.gen.h
|
rm -f engine/modules/modules_enabled.gen.h
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user